Academics: Nine Penguins Named To
All-League Winter Sports Squads
Indianapolis, Ind.
--
Headlined by seven indoor track and
field selections, the Youngstown
State winter sports squads -- indoor
track and field, men's and women's
basketball and women's swimming and
diving -- had nine Academic
All-Horizon League selections, the
conference announced on Thursday.
The seven indoor track and field athletes who were named
academic all-conference were Bethany
Anderson, Lindsay Cobey, Jarrod
Davis, Dave Mealy, Nick Smith, Drew
Weizer and Katy Williams. Joining
those individuals were senior Ashlee
Russo who was one of five
student-athletes selected to the
women's basketball squad and junior
Becky Bertuzzi who was named the to
the swimming and diving academic
all-league team.
YSU's total of nine student-athletes named to a total of six
teams ranked fifth overall in the
conference. Excluding the men's
swimming and diving category, which
Youngstown State does not sponsor,
the Penguins had the third-highest
total in the five other sports.
For the year, YSU has a total of 11 All-Horizon League
academic selections, including
volleyball student-athlete Abby
Ettenhofer and cross country
standout Emily Cicero in the fall. |
